Karl Zeiss
0 sources
Karl Zeiss
Summary
Karl Zeiss is a human[1]. He was born in Langgöns[2]. He was born on April 15, 1912[3]. He passed away in Giessen[4]. He died on January 10, 1994[5]. He worked as a theologian[6]. He is known by 4 alternative names across languages and contexts.[7]
